2001 ford taurus DOHC Heat

Since the winter started i am getting no heat it blows cold. Car is not running cold or hot and is warming up properly so i do not think it is the thermostat overflow is full with antifreeze so what else could be causing heater to blow cold. Sometimes if i drive for a while and let heat build up i will get heat for maybe 1 minute but then blows cold again any thoughts?
